Implementação de rede LoRa Mesh aplicada em smart cities
Resumo
Resumo : Este trabalho tem como objetivo implementar e avaliar o desempenho de um protocolo de roteamento para redes LoRa mesh (malha), para aplicações com comunicação multi-hop (múltiplos saltos) sem fio para cidades inteligentes. Para isso, foi realizado um estudo e definição da placa de desenvolvimento, para então realizar a seleção do protocolo de roteamento. Então, foram realizados os ajustes necessários para a implementação do protocolo LoRaMesher com a função de múltiplos saltos, e desenvolvido um canal de comunicação TCP, para aplicar a implementação de um gateway (ponte entre camada da roteamento e a camada de aplicação) na rede. Além disso foram acrescentadas métricas para análise do desempenho do protocolo como a taxa de entrega de pacotes e a sobrecarga de controle. Em experimentos de campo, foi possível observar troca de mensagens entre os dispositivos e atualização da tabela de rotas de cada um com a quantidade de saltos entre eles. Os resultados confirmam o funcionamento proposto nos objetivos para cenários multi-hop, contribuindo para aplicações em cidades inteligentes Abstract : This work aims to implement and evaluate the performance of a routing protocol for LoRa mesh networks, focusing on multi-hop wireless communication for smart cities applications. To achieve this, the study began by selecting and defining the development board, followed by choosing the appropriate routing protocol. Necessary adjustments were then made to implement the LoRaMesher protocol with multi-hop functionality, and a TCP socket was developed to apply the implementation of a gateway in the network. Additionally, metrics such as Packet Delivery Ratio and and Control Overhead were included for performance analysis. Field experiments confirmed that devices exchanged messages and updated their routing tables, including the number of hops between them. The results validate the proposed objectives for multi-hop scenarios, contributing to applications in smart cities
Collections
- Engenharia Elétrica [40]